Government Approves Subsidy Rates for Kharif 2026 Fertilizers
The Union Cabinet, led by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i, has given the green light to a proposal from the Department of Fertilizers to establish the Nutrient Based Subsidy (NBS) rates for the Kharif Season of 2026. This initiative, effective from April 1, 2026, to September 30, 2026, will impact Phosphatic and Potassic (P&K) fertilizers, with a projected subsidy budget of approximately Rs. 41,533.81 crore. This amount represents an increase of around Rs. 4,317 crore over the budget allocated for the Kharif 2025 season, which was set at Rs. 37,216.15 crore.

Background on Fertilizer Subsidies
The Indian government has been providing a range of 28 grades of P&K fertilizers, such as DAP, to farmers at subsidized prices through domestic manufacturers and importers. The NBS Scheme, which has been in effect since April 1, 2010, governs the subsidy process, reflecting the government’s commitment to support farmers in maintaining the affordability of vital fertilizers.
In response to current trends impacting international prices of fertilizers and other inputs like Urea, DAP, MOP, and Sulphur, the government has approved these NBS rates for Kharif 2026.
